Output d66781b592d0d8c785f42b73015b61da7d9696071a2924348eea81b69266da02:7

value
17313
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5d67172f8fd2ea6127fbd8ced56ec6f263b648560a0a27e4013d3098e51ab088
address
bc1pt4n3wtu06t4xzflmmr8d2mkx7f3mvjzkpg9z0eqp85cf3eg6kzyqmdr37d
transaction
d66781b592d0d8c785f42b73015b61da7d9696071a2924348eea81b69266da02
spent
true